报表如何获取过滤条件

栏目:云苍穹知识作者:金蝶来源:金蝶云社区发布:2024-09-23浏览:1

报表如何获取过滤条件

问题描述

报表取数插件中如何获取过滤条件


解决方法

    @Override
    public DataSet query(ReportQueryParam queryParam, Object o) throws Throwable {
        Map<String, Object> customParam = queryParam.getCustomParam();
        FilterInfo filter = queryParam.getFilter();
        List<FilterItemInfo> filterItems = filter.getFilterItems();
        for (FilterItemInfo filterItem : filterItems) {
            //key
            String propName = filterItem.getPropName();
            //value
            Object value = filterItem.getValue();
        }
        //根据过滤条件构建QFilter对象,再通过QueryServiceHelper.queryDataSet获取dataset对象返回
        //....取数代码
        return null;
    }


参考资料



报表如何获取过滤条件

问题描述报表取数插件中如何获取过滤条件解决方法 @Override public DataSet query(ReportQueryParam queryParam, Object o) throws ...
点击下载文档
确认删除?
回到顶部
客服QQ
  • 客服QQ点击这里给我发消息